The Inspector-General of Police (IGP), Usman Alkali Baba, on Monday, directed the suspension of permit for usage of tinted windscreens in vehicles across the country.
The IGP made this pronouncement during a meeting with senior police officers including commissioners and DIGs from across the states.
Baba also warned his officers against the mounting of roadblocks, stressing that heads of commands must enforce it and key into the road patrol strategy as an alternative to roadblocks.
According to the IGP, senior police officers must be discipline in their various commands.
Recall that former military President, General Ibrahim Babangida in February 1991 promulgated a decree prohibiting the use of cars with tinted glasses.
The decree is now known as the Motor Vehicles (Prohibition of Tinted Glass) Act, 1991; made up of six (6) sections.
